DescriptionJob Title: Advanced Practice Provider
We are seeking an experienced Advanced Practice Provider to join our healthcare team.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in providing high-quality patient care and be able to work collaboratively with physicians and other healthcare professionals. Pain management, orthopedic, or neurosurgery, experience preferred.
Responsibilities:
- Conduct patient assessments and develop treatment plans
- Order and interpret diagnostic tests
- Prescribe medications and other treatments
- Provide patient education and counseling
- Collaborate with physicians and other healthcare professionals to provide comprehensive patient care
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date patient records
Requirements:
- Master's degree in Nursing or Physician Assistant Studies
- Current state licensure as an Advanced Practice Provider
- Minimum of 2 years of experience in a clinical setting
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team
- Excellent problem-solving and critical thinking skills
